Maltese Dog Price Guide: What to Expect & How to Cut Costs

Acquiring a charming Maltese puppy can be quite exciting undertaking, but understanding the average cost is essential . Typically, you can foresee to pay between $500 and $2000 for a quality Maltese from a trusted breeder. But, prices may vary significantly based on elements like ancestry, show quality , location, and the seller’s reputation . In addition, adopting a Maltese from a nearby rescue often costs approximately $300 to $1000, covering initial shots and sometimes spaying or neutering. To reduce your overall expense, think about adopting, searching for an breeder offering lower prices, and meticulously researching multiple options.

Teacup Maltese for Sale: Finding a Sound & Fair Source

So, you're wanting to purchase a sweet miniature Maltese? Wonderful! However, finding a honest seller is absolutely essential to ensure you’re getting a healthy puppy. Many unethical individuals take advantage of the demand for these petite dogs. Be extremely cautious of listings that promise unrealistic perfection. Consistently visit the facilities yourself, if possible , to observe the environment of the puppies and meet the parent dogs . A quality breeder will be pleased to answer your inquiries and show you to view health documentation . Here are a few key things to remember :

  • Inquire about health clearances for hip issues, eye examinations , and patellar instability .
  • Double-check the source's credibility through online testimonials and community animal doctors.
  • Don't buy from breeders who insist on adopt a puppy instantly or discourage you from seeing the puppy's parents .

Ultimately, a well-adjusted miniature Maltese is a blessing – but only if you’ve done your research and selected an humane source. Keep in mind that ethical practices is paramount to a happy relationship together.

The True Cost of a Maltese: Beyond the Initial Price Tag

Acquiringbringing home a Maltese puppydog can seem straightforward, with pricescosts often ranging from approximately $800 to $2000. However, the overall expense extends well past that initial fee. Regular pet services, including routine checkupsand shots can easily reach thousands over time. Furthermore, groomingis a recurring need isn’t cheapis a significant factor, and specialized dog food, treats also contributes to the ongoing financial responsibility. Don’t forget the cost of toys, training instruction, and potential damage replacement – owning a Maltese get more info is a considerable commitment that requires careful assessment!
